This article develops a methodology aimed at generating a systematic social diagnosis of social and natural landscapes. The analytical process is divided into six easily replicable and causatively connected steps. The goal is two-fold: first, to present the inextricable connections between physical landscapes and the communities that occupy them. And second, to provide a fundamental tool to public policy designers that should simultaneously improve social acceptability of conservation policies and policy efficiency and effectiveness. Finally, this methodology is consciously heterogeneous from a theoretical perspective. This article puts together, in fruitful dialogue, contributions from varying places on the social theory spectrum: from political economy to poststructural theory.  相似文献

阐述了我国及其他国家环境监测市场管理的经验,以及我国在推进环境监测市场化管理方面的探索;指出了目前环境监测市场化管理中存在的问题,提出,应加快建立适合国情的监测总体格局;建立完善环境监测社会化监管制度体系;充分发挥行业协会在监管中的作用;强化对社会监测机构监管力度;提高社会环境监测机构能力。  相似文献

浅谈环境监测社会化的质量监管新思路   总被引:1,自引:0,他引:1  
分析了现阶段社会环境检测市场的发展现状及存在的问题,探讨了从环境检测上岗能力、专业技能再教育、从业履历和信用等方面对社会环境检测从业人员进行管理的必要性,提出在机构环境监测能力、检测人员结构流动性、仪器设备在用状态和更新频率、从事环境监测业务信用等方面建立评估机制,推动环境监测市场健康发展。  相似文献

One approach for performing uncertainty assessment in flood inundation modeling is to use an ensemble of models with different conceptualizations, parameters, and initial and boundary conditions that capture the factors contributing to uncertainty. However, the high computational expense of many hydraulic models renders their use impractical for ensemble forecasting. To address this challenge, we developed a rating curve library method for flood inundation forecasting. This method involves pre‐running a hydraulic model using multiple inflows and extracting rating curves, which prescribe a relation between streamflow and stage at various cross sections along a river reach. For a given streamflow, flood stage at each cross section is interpolated from the pre‐computed rating curve library to delineate flood inundation depths and extents at a lower computational cost. In this article, we describe the workflow for our rating curve library method and the Rating Curve based Automatic Flood Forecasting (RCAFF) software that automates this workflow. We also investigate the feasibility of using this method to transform ensemble streamflow forecasts into local, probabilistic flood inundation delineations for the Onion and Shoal Creeks in Austin, Texas. While our results show water surface elevations from RCAFF are comparable to those from the hydraulic models, the ensemble streamflow forecasts used as inputs to RCAFF are the largest source of uncertainty in predicting observed floods.  相似文献

This article provides a timely review of the interdisciplinary and disjointed literature on social sustainability and identifies some readily available measures of this concept for American cities. Based upon a comprehensive review of the literature, four broad dimensions are identified as being reflective of social sustainability: equal access and opportunity, environmental justice, community and the value of place, and basic human needs. Breaking these four dimensions into measurable indicators, this research provides a method for researchers and for American cities to begin to evaluate and to assess social sustainability efforts within their jurisdictions.  相似文献

Public participation in water decision-making is an accepted and expected practice. It is expected to lead to better decisions and ensure fairness by satisfying peoples' understanding of democracy and their “right” to participate in decisions that affect them. However, despite years of experience and “best practices”, governing bodies at all levels struggle to implement successful, genuine participation that leads to fair decisions. Ultimately, decision-making about natural resources such as water is a process that takes place in a wider power context where some groups have greater access to sources of power and entitlements. This research applies a “Social Justice Framework” (SJF) to examine the experiences of different stakeholder groups in making their voices heard during water reform processes in the Murray–Darling Basin in Australia. The experiences of croppers and graziers in two different floodplains show how historical advantages and disadvantages affect the power balance between different stakeholder groups and their ability to participate in and influence water decision-making. Applying the three components of the SJF, distributive, procedural and interactive justice, in water decision-making should lead to greater equity in distribution and underline the importance of good governance in decision-making processes.  相似文献

Dissipation curves of azoxystrobin and of the neonicotinoids acetamiprid and thiacloprid in peach; azinphos-methyl and carbaryl in pear and azoxystrobin, chlorfenapyr and chlorpyrifos in high-tunnel tomato crops were studied in the Southern region of Uruguay. An analytical methodology based on solid phase extraction (SPE) and detection by High Performance Liquid Chromatography with Diode Array Detector (HPLC/DAD) was used for acetamiprid and thiacloprid. Coupled SPE and detection by Gas Chromatography with Mass Selective Detector (GC/MSD) was used for the detection of azinphos-methyl, azoxystrobin, carbaryl, chlorfenapyr and chlorpyrifos residues. Curves were modeled mathematically with Solver program of Microsoft Excel®. The best fit for acetamiprid and thiacloprid in peach was achieved with the exponential model (r2=0.961 and 0.944, respectively). In the case of peach fruits there is not a Maximum Residue Limit (MRL) for acetamiprid in the Codex Alimentarius, while 0.5 mg/kg is the value rated for thiacloprid. The MRLs accepted by the European Union (EU) are 0.1 mg/kg for acetamiprid and 0.3 mg/kg for thiacloprid. According to the curves determined in these experiments, thiacloprid residues 10 to 12 days after application (daa) were below the MRLs established by both sources. In the case of acetamiprid, 25 daa would be required, according to the exponential mathematical model, to get residues levels below the MRL values established by the EU. For azinphos methyl in pear, the residues detected were mathematically fitted to an exponential model (r2=0.999). According to it, residue levels under the MRL established by the EU (0.05 mg/kg) are gotten in our conditions in 20 daa. In plastic tunnel tomato chlorfenapyr residues were not detected from 16 daa, having the dissipation curve an exponential trend. In the same condition, there was not a decay of the azoxystrobin concentration during a 24-day trial, being it around 0.40 ± 0.05 mg/kg.  相似文献

Do natural resources reduce social trust? This paper reviews the literature on natural resources and on trust. The existing theoretical and empirical literature suggests that natural resources can reduce trust through several indirect mechanisms. Notably, studies show that natural resources lead to institutional degradation, corruption, inequality, and civil war, all of which have been associated with reduced trust. In addition, game theoretical work on windfall gains suggests that there may be direct effect of natural resources on trust. This paper tests empirically whether there is a direct effect of natural resources on trust (The Pearl Hypothesis), using cross-country data. The results indicate that no such direct effect exists, but we find a significant effect on trust of intermediate variables affected by natural resources, such as institutions, corruption, inequality and/or civil war. Importantly, the relationship between corruption and trust turns out to be non-linear, indicating that the effect of natural resources on trust depends on the initial corruption level of a country. In highly corrupt societies, institutional improvements that reduce corruption may also undermine trust, which poses difficult challenges for anti-corruption policy.  相似文献

Yiping Fang 《Ambio》2013,42(5):566-576
The three-rivers headwater region (THRHR) of Qinghai province, China plays a key role as source of fresh water and ecosystem services for central and eastern China. Global warming and human activities in the THRHR have threatened the ecosystem since the 1980s. Therefore, the Chinese government has included managing of the THRHR in the national strategy since 2003. The State Integrated Test and Demonstration Region of the THRHR highlights the connection with social engineering (focus on improving people’s livelihood and well-being) in managing nature reserves. Based on this program, this perspective attempts a holistic analysis of the strategic role of the THRHR, requirements for change, indices of change, and approaches to change. Long-term success of managing nature reserves requires effective combination of ecological conservation, economic development, and social progress. Thus, the philosophy of social engineering should be employed as a strategy to manage the THRHR.  相似文献

Abstract: Marine protected areas (MPAs) have been highlighted as a means toward effective conservation of coral reefs. New strategies are required to more effectively select MPA locations and increase the pace of their implementation. Many criteria exist to design MPA networks, but generally, it is recommended that networks conserve a diversity of species selected for, among other attributes, their representativeness, rarity, or endemicity. Because knowledge of species’ spatial distribution remains scarce, efficient surrogates are urgently needed. We used five different levels of habitat maps and six spatial scales of analysis to identify under which circumstances habitat data used to design MPA networks for Wallis Island provided better representation of species than random choice alone. Protected‐area site selections were derived from a rarity–complementarity algorithm. Habitat surrogacy was tested for commercial fish species, all fish species, commercially harvested invertebrates, corals, and algae species. Efficiency of habitat surrogacy varied by species group, type of habitat map, and spatial scale of analysis. Maps with the highest habitat thematic complexity provided better surrogates than simpler maps and were more robust to changes in spatial scales. Surrogates were most efficient for commercial fishes, corals, and algae but not for commercial invertebrates. Conversely, other measurements of species‐habitat associations, such as richness congruence and composition similarities provided weak results. We provide, in part, a habitat‐mapping methodology for designation of MPAs for Pacific Ocean islands that are characterized by habitat zonations similar to Wallis. Given the increasing availability and affordability of space‐borne imagery to map habitats, our approach could appreciably facilitate and improve current approaches to coral reef conservation and enhance MPA implementation.  相似文献
